mysql jsonb类型 mysql中json是什么类型

mysql和json有什么区别和联系根本不是一回事,json是一种数据格式 , 而mysql是一个关系数据库管理系统 。二者没有直接的关系 。
MySQL支持JSON数据类型 。相比于Json格式的字符串类型,JSON数据类型的优势有:存储在JSON列中的任何JSON文档的大小都受系统变量 max_allowed_packet 的值的限制 , 可以使用 JSON_STORAGE_SIZE() 函数获得存储JSON文档所需的空间 。
JSON支持和NoSQL:PostgreSQL最近增加了JSON支持,与传统的关系型数据库相比,它提供了更大的数据存储灵活性 , 因此,这方面PostgreSQL胜过MySQL 。
JSON(JavaScript Object Notation) 是一种轻量级的数据交换格式 , 主要用于传送数据 。
mysql中的json数据类型MySQL0.3及更高版本中,有两种合并函数: JSON_MERGE_PRESERVE() 和 JSON_MERGE_PATCH()。下面具讨论它们的区别 。
mysql 7 josn官方文档地址 我这里 json_content 就定义的是json类型 , 下面就是基本的操作,后续会写一些json函数 。这算是一个比较复杂的json了,array里面放的是一个数组,other放了另一个对象 。下面我再插入几条数据 。
mysql专门对json数据提供了相应的访问方式 , 比如你要的其实就是sum函数;sql代码例如:1 select sum(data-$.height) from table_name;其中的table_name是假设你的表名叫table_name 。
JSON的格式非常简单:名称/键值 。之前MySQL版本里面要实现这样的存储,要么用VARCHAR要么用TEXT大文本 。MySQL7发布后,专门设计了JSON数据类型以及关于这种类型的检索以及其他函数解析 。我们先看看MySQL老版本的JSON存取 。
mysql中char和varchar区别在MySQL中,CHAR和VARCHAR是两种用于存储文本数据的数据类型,它们的区别:存储方式不同、存储空间不同、性能不同、适用场景不同 。存储方式不同 CHAR:CHAR是固定长度的字符类型,它会在存储时自动填充空格以达到指定的长度 。
都是用来存储字符串的,只是他们的保存方式不一样 。char有固定的长度,而varchar属于可变长的字符类型 。
char和varchar的区别 char和varchar是mysql中的两个相似的列 , 都可以存储字符和字符串 。但是char存储的列的长度是不可变的,varchar存储的列的长度是可变的 。
【mysql jsonb类型 mysql中json是什么类型】数据库中char和varchar的区别为:长度不同、效率不同、存储不同 。长度不同 char类型:char类型的长度是固定的 。varchar类型:varchar类型的长度是可变的 。
mysql 中 char 、 varvhar 、 nvarchar 都是用来 存储字符串 的 , 只是他们的存储方式不一样 。固定长度的非Unicode字符数据 , 最大长度8000个字符 。
请问谁能详细介绍mysql的数据类型呢?MySQL常见数据类型:[数值]、[日期时间]和[字符串]类型 。
MySQL支持大量的列类型,它可以被分为3类:数字类型、日期和时间类型以及字符串(字符)类型 。本节首先给出可用类型的一个概述,并且总结每个列类型的存储需求,然后提供每个类中的类型性质的更详细的描述 。
Mysql支持的多种数据类型主要有:数值数据类型、日期/时间类型、字符串类型 。
mysql有几种数据类型呢?分别是哪几种呢?1、该系统数据类型分为数值类型、字符类型、日期和时间类型等三种 。数值类型:包括有符号整型(int)、无符号整型(bigint)、单精度浮点型(float)、双精度浮点型(double)等 。
2、MySQL支持多种类型,大致可以分为四类:数值型、浮点型、日期/时间和字符串(字符)类型 。数值型 MySQL支持所有标准SQL数值数据类型 。
3、Mysql支持的多种数据类型主要有:数值数据类型、日期/时间类型、字符串类型 。Mysql支持所有标准SQL中的数值类型 , 其中包括整数型的tinyint和bigint,小数型的decimal 。
4、MySQL 提供了8个基本的字符串类型,分别:CHAR、VARCHAR、BINARY、VARBINARY、BLOB、TEXT、ENUM 各SET等多种字符串类型 。可以存储的范围从简单的一个字符到巨大的文本块或二进制字符串数据 。
5、MySQL数据类型在 MySQL 中,有三种主要的类型:Text(文本)、Number(数字)和 Date/Time(日期/时间)类型 。话不多说,直接上图 。
6、MySQL支持多种类型,大致可以分为三类:数值、日期/时间和字符串(字符)类型 。推荐教程:MySQL入门视频教程数值类型MySQL支持所有标准SQL数值数据类型 。

    推荐阅读